When you gather with your friends and family to share wine, you should always enjoy the experience. There are different approaches on how to optimize these experiences and one of them is to have a theme. A certain theme of what wines to partake with one another can really heighten the enjoyment. I recommend having a common thread between each wine. That can be either a varietal, a region, a certain producer, or the characteristic quality of the wine. That character can be full bodied or medium bodied. Aromatic white varietals or tannic red wines. Find something you can all agree with in sharing that experience with. Be open to trying new wines from new regions. You never know when you find your next must-have wine!
